Furlan Marri Flyback

The Furlan Marri Flyback is widely praised for its vintage-inspired design, 38mm case size, and elegant sector dials, with several sources highlighting its exceptional value proposition. Owners and reviewers consistently commend the watch's classical dimensions and thinness, particularly the 10.9mm thickness mentioned by one source. The Sellita AMT5100 movement, featuring a flyback function and column-wheel, is noted for its decoration and reliability, offering a power reserve around 58-63 hours. Readability is also a strong point, with one reference specifically mentioning the taupe dial's excellent contrast. However, one reviewer flags the pushers as appearing small, and another criticizes the case thickness exceeding 13mm, describing it as a "hamburger-on-wrist" despite efforts to mitigate the bulk with a short lug-to-lug and domed crystal.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Furlan Marri Flyback highly for its sophisticated vintage aesthetics and strong value at its price point.

Baltic MR Classic

Owners widely praise the Baltic MR Classic's attractive dial with applied Breguet numerals and granular texture, noting it looks far more expensive than its price. Reviewers highlight the refined, dressy aesthetic and the visually appealing micro-rotor movement. Some owners report precise time-setting and a smooth winding action. Accuracy figures vary, with one owner seeing +1 second per day and another averaging +10 seconds per day. Concerns exist regarding the gold PVD finish's durability, with reports of wear from strap friction. The 36mm case is described as small, and some find the bezel chunky and the watch's overall height significant. The Chinese Hangzhou micro-rotor movement is noted as potentially noisy and difficult for local repair, though Baltic's customer service and warranty are praised.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Baltic MR Classic highly for its dressy aesthetic and dial finishing at its price point.
